St Andrewgate is tucked quarters behind Kings Square within the
walls of the city of York, with the property offering well balanced
accommodation boasting a number of charming period features
including timber sash windows, decorative cornicing and picture
rails with the advantage of a garage and additional off street
parking.
The property opens via steps to an entrance hallway with the
lounge with fireplace to the front elevation and is open to the
dining room. Due to the corner position of the property, there are
two aspects of natural light including an attractive window view
onto the 15th Century St Andrews Evangelical Church from the dining
room.
The kitchen comprises of a series of wall and base units and
include an eye level oven and grill, gas hob with extractor hood,
integrated fridge and freezer with undercounter dishwasher and
washing machine. There is a door from the kitchen to the rear of
the property with flagstone paving and accesses St Andrews Court
where the garage and parking space is conveniently situated.
Stairs from the entrance hallway lead to a first floor landing
with two bedrooms including the master bedroom with generous
proportions spanning the width of the house. Both bedrooms have
built in storage in addition to storage cupboards off the landing.
The bedrooms are served by both a bathroom with bath, sink and
toilet with an additional WC with toilet and sink.
In addition to the core living accommodation is a basement with
restricted head height accessed from the kitchen and a second floor
accessed via steps with two loft rooms. The elevated position
offers views across the roof tops capturing the top of the York
Minster.

LOCATION
The property is situated in the centre of the historical city of
York. Famed for its city walls and York Minster, one of Europes
largest cathedrals of its kind, York is one of the countries most
visited locations, attracting those looking to take advantage of
the many bars, restaurants, historic and cultural attractions the
city offers. The mainline train station offers services to London
in under two hours and road links mean nearby cities such as Leeds
and Harrogate are easily reached.
